摘要: 采用高温固相烧结法制备了Sm2(Ge1-xHfx)2O7(x=0,0.025,0.05,0.075,0.1)固溶体,并对其相组成、显微组织及热物理性能进行了分析.结果表明,所合成的固溶体具有单一的萤石结构,其相对致密度均在90;以上.Hf掺杂增强了声子的散射程度,从而使其热导率与Sm2Ce2O7相比明显降低.Hf较小的离子半径使得其热膨胀系数随HfO2掺杂量增加而降低,但仍然满足热障涂层的要求.
